Poro handed its first loss

Sepik FC concluded 14 rounds of play on a high note, with a 3-1 victory over Poro. 

Now the team has its sights set on its first semi-final match. 

Sepik FC had lost to Poro in the first round of matches where they lost 4-nil. 

This time, they taking back their power and finished on a high note. 

Coach Gordon Torovu had said pre-match that the match against Poro would be fine tune their preparation for the semi-final against FC Genesis.

The win against Poro puts Sepik FC in a good headspace, before they face FC Genesis.
